Bail bond agents normally cost 10% from the bail amount upfront in return for his or her services and will demand supplemental fees. Some states have place a cap of eight% on the amount billed.

Collateral performs an important purpose in how bail bonds do the job. Generally, defendants will require to publish collateral with their bail bondsman to include the full bail amount of money and lower the chance of the accused skipping their foreseeable future court docket dates.

Bail is definitely the follow of releasing suspects from custody in advance of their hearing, on payment of bail, which can be revenue or pledge of property to the court which may be refunded if suspects return to court for his or her trial. In America the techniques fluctuate among states.[1]

Failure to look with a court docket date results in a forfeited bond. Bail bonds have certain obligations for defendants unveiled from jail on bail.
